Wow, I was shocked by the positive reviews, I should have checked the negative ones first. I can confirm all the negative reviews are spot on. Visited on 7/1 with my toddler and husband for a fun evening of jumping. It quickly turned sour as soon as we entered the location. It reeked of stale food and mildew (red flag one). We proceeded to pay $45 for 3 people to jump for one hour. I got charged even though I already had grip socks (flag two). Once inside over 50% of the attractions were shut down, (toddler maze, big kid maze, and ball pit) red flag three. A worker notified us there was an accident in the ball pit (I assume bathroom but unsure). The entire place was filthy. Mildew growing on surfaces, old gum stains on trampolines, gaping holes in multiple trampolines; which is a lawsuit waiting to happen. Please save your hard earned money and go to a safer establishment that actually cares about their customers and facility.

I was there for my Grand Nephews Birthday. This place is a kids dream of with many playing choices. There of course is a huge trampoline park in the middle of the place, arcade games, a pool area with huge inflatable balls that a kid gets into & rolls around on water, soccer, bumper cars, dodge ball, zip lines and much much more. A kid couldn't do everything in this place in a day. There are also picnic tables to celebrate a birthday and for those paying extra a private room for a family gathering is also available. A total of 10 rooms are available. There are plenty of helpful employees to help if it is needed. The food available for purchase though is questionable. I ordered some chicken tenders with French fries, the tenders although served Hot were a bit dry & the fries had too much salt. Nevertheless if you want your kids to have a Amazing time then take them to Bounce Bounce.😁
